Apocalyptic & Post-Apocalyptic Movies:

Logan's Run - Post-holocaust world. People live in domed cities and are supposed to end their lives at age 30. Two people escape to the surface world. Based on a novel.

The Island - A man goes on the run after he discovers that he is actually a "harvested being", and is being kept along with others in a utopian facility.

On the Beach, Fail Safe& Dr. Strangelove - 1950s Nuclear Threat movies. On the Beach tells of a post-holocaust Australia and the lone US Destroyer still serving. Describes how everyone deals with their eventual fate. Strangelove is a classic black comedy about the accidental bombing of Russia. Fail Safe also deals with an accidental attack on the USSR.

Testament & The Day After - Nuclear War and the days immediately following.

On the Manga/Anime front check out Akira - A secret military project endangers Neo-Tokyo when it turns a biker gang member into a rampaging psionic psychopath that only two kids and a group of psionics can stop.
